Predictive Analysis and Forecasting Models in Cosmetic Surgery

Predictive analysis and forecasting models in cosmetic surgery are significant tools that help to anticipate the future trends in this medical field. These predictive models utilize historical data, current trends, and statistical techniques to forecast future events. In the context of breast augmentation for asymmetry, such models can be highly useful in predicting the expected number of patients in 2024.

The process of predictive analysis usually involves collecting data about past procedures, analyzing the factors that influenced the decisions, and using this information to predict future trends. For instance, if there has been a steady increase in the number of breast augmentation procedures for asymmetry in the past few years, one might expect this trend to continue in the future. Similarly, if certain factors, such as improved medical technology or societal attitudes towards cosmetic surgery, have led to an increase in these procedures, these factors may continue to influence the trend in the future.

Forecasting models in cosmetic surgery can range from simple linear regression models, which predict the future based on a single variable, to more complex models that consider multiple factors. For instance, a simple model might predict the number of breast augmentation procedures for asymmetry in 2024 based on the current rate of increase. A more complex model might take into account factors such as the aging population, advances in surgical techniques, and changes in societal attitudes towards cosmetic surgery.

Factors Influencing the Increase in Breast Augmentation for Asymmetry

Breast asymmetry is a common concern for many women, and it can significantly impact their self-esteem and body image. As a result, the demand for breast augmentation to correct asymmetry is expected to rise in the coming years. There are several factors contributing to this increase.

Firstly, there is increased awareness and understanding of the issue of breast asymmetry. With advancements in medicine, more women are becoming aware that this is a common problem, and that there are surgical options available to correct it. This increased awareness is leading to more women seeking out these procedures.

Secondly, improvements in surgical techniques and technologies are making breast augmentation procedures safer, more effective, and less invasive. This makes the procedure more appealing to prospective patients, as it reduces the risk of complications and improves the likelihood of a successful outcome.

Thirdly, societal attitudes towards cosmetic surgery are changing. It is becoming more socially acceptable to undergo cosmetic procedures, and there is less stigma associated with choosing to have these operations. This shift in societal attitudes is leading to more women feeling comfortable with the decision to undergo breast augmentation for asymmetry.

Finally, the availability and accessibility of cosmetic surgery are also increasing. With more clinics and surgeons offering these procedures, and with financing options making them more affordable, more women have the opportunity to undergo breast augmentation for asymmetry.

In conclusion, a combination of increased awareness, improved surgical techniques, shifting societal attitudes, and increased accessibility are contributing to the predicted increase in the number of patients undergoing breast augmentation for asymmetry in 2024.
